| Brand | - |
| Category | Personal Care, Health & Massage Equipment / Reading Glasses |
| Origin | - |
| Frame Material | Ultra-light TR90 Polymer |
| Lens Technology | HD Blue Light Blocking Coating |
| Available Strengths | +1.50, +1.75, +2.00, +2.25, +2.50, +2.75, +3.00 |
| Frame Style | Classic Rectangular Full Rim |
| Temple Length | 145mm |
| Bridge Width | 18mm |
| Lens Width | 54mm |
| Weight | 18 grams |
| Color Options | Matte Black, Tortoise Shell, Gunmetal Grey |
| Package Includes | Glasses, Hard Case, Cleaning Cloth, User Manual |

Q: Is the lens material glass or plastic?
A: The lenses are made from high-quality polycarbonate resin, which is impact-resistant and lighter than glass, making them safer and more comfortable for daily wear.

Q: Can I use these for driving at night?
A: We do not recommend using blue light blocking reading glasses for night driving, as the tint may reduce visibility in low-light conditions. These are designed specifically for screen use and reading indoors.
Q: Are replacement nose pads available?
A: Yes, the frame features standard screw-in nose pads. While we do not sell them separately on this page, any local optical shop can easily replace them with standard silicone pads if needed.
Q: Do these glasses come with a prescription from an optometrist?
A: No, these are non-prescription ready-made reading glasses with fixed magnification strengths. We recommend consulting your eye doctor to determine the correct diopter strength for your needs before purchasing.
